Output af26df81cf783f34adb5510d56ee83a214a269dd5df2e27c4d4b360333eedd78:0

value
12876924
script pubkey
OP_0 OP_PUSHBYTES_20 86833a47af151f45fa1673a8e5a98d31d604a810
address
bc1qs6pn53a0z505t7skww5wt2vdx8tqf2qstky9ut
transaction
af26df81cf783f34adb5510d56ee83a214a269dd5df2e27c4d4b360333eedd78
confirmations
191605
spent
true